Justin Bieber "Sorry" Song Meaning & Lyrics: Decoding the Hit

Justin Bieber’s “Sorry” marked a turning point in his career, shifting from teen pop to a more mature pop sound rooted in apology and redemption. The track’s smooth production and introspective lyrics helped redefine his artistic identity and broadened his global audience.

Released as a single and later included on his album Purpose, “Sorry” showcased a deliberate musical evolution and became a commercial milestone. Understanding its context and impact reveals how the song resonated across markets and solidified his presence in the global music landscape.

The Sound and Structure of Sorry

Musical Composition and Production

The production of “Sorry” relies on tropical house elements, featuring understated percussion, synth pads, and a syncopated bassline. This approach gives the track an airy yet compelling groove that supports Bieber’s restrained vocal delivery.

Lyrics and Emotional Arc

Lyrically, the song addresses a personal apology, acknowledging mistakes and expressing a desire for reconciliation. The straightforward message, paired with the laid-back rhythm, creates an intimate confession rather than a generic pop hook.

Commercial Performance and Global Reach

Chart Achievements

“Sorry” dominated charts worldwide, reaching number one on the Billboard Hot 100, UK Singles Chart, and numerous other national rankings. Its longevity on streaming platforms further highlights sustained listener engagement beyond initial release spikes.

Streaming and Sales Metrics

Strong streaming numbers and robust digital sales contributed to multi-million unit certifications across regions. The song’s performance helped boost overall streams for the Purpose album and expanded Bieber’s audience in emerging markets.

Cultural Impact and Legacy

As one of the defining tropical house tracks, “Sorry” influenced a wave of pop productions that incorporated similar rhythmic and textural elements. Its success demonstrated the commercial viability of this sound for mainstream artists seeking evolution.

Public Perception and Fan Response

Fans and critics alike highlighted the song’s sincerity and production quality. The visual content, including music videos and live performances, reinforced the theme of seeking forgiveness and contributed to a refreshed public image for Bieber.

How does “Sorry” differ from Justin Bieber’s earlier hits?

Unlike earlier tracks that leaned heavily on upbeat, radio-friendly formulas, “Sorry” embraces a more minimalist tropical house production, focusing on mood and lyrical sincerity over high-energy hooks.

What inspired the lyrical theme of apology in “Sorry”?

The song reflects personal accountability and the desire to repair relationships, aligning with Bieber’s broader artistic shift toward mature themes during the Purpose era.

Did “Sorry” perform better than other singles from Purpose?

While several Purpose singles achieved strong chart positions, “Sorry” stood out for its sustained chart run and streaming performance, becoming a defining single of the project.

How has “Sorry” been performed live compared to the studio version?

Live renditions often emphasize vocal control and band interaction, scaling back electronic elements to highlight lyrical delivery and audience connection during concerts.
